Summary:PROBLEM TO BE SOLVED: To provide a detecting method of a phosphor that can suppress high cost and exactly detect the existence of inorganic phosphors, even if organic phosphors exist in resin material. SOLUTION: In this detecting method of the phosphor, a phosphor (m) is detected, based on light quantity of wavelength conversion light b1 emitted from the phosphor (m), by exciting phosphors (m) and (n) added into the resin material A. The detection method comprises an exciting process of exciting the phosphor (m) extended for a predetermined time, and a process of measuring the light quantity of the wavelength conversion light b1 after a predetermined time has elapsed after completion of the exciting process and the phosphor (m) is detected.
